The Essence of BsCscan API Key: Unlocking Blockchain Data

The BsCscan API is essentially an access token or key that grants its holder direct, programmatic access to data from the popular block explorer and analytics platform, BscScan. This API allows developers and researchers to extract real-time information about transactions on the Binance Smart Chain (BSC), including transaction details, smart contract interactions, balances of tokens in accounts, and more.

The API key can be seen as akin to a digital key that opens up access to an expansive database of blockchain events, making it possible for users to retrieve data programmatically without direct interaction with the Binance Smart Chain network itself. How It Works: Navigating Through Blockchain Events

To understand how BsCscan API keys work, it's essential first to grasp that a blockchain is essentially a distributed ledger of transactions—a chronological record of all financial transactions occurring across a network of computers. Each transaction involves the transfer of digital assets from one user to another. The BscScan API key provides developers with the ability to programmatically access this ledger for specific events, such as:

Transaction Information: Retrieving details about any transaction on the BSC, including sender and recipient addresses, amounts transferred, gas fees paid, etc.

Smart Contract Interactions: Gaining insights into smart contract activities, such as deployment, function calls, or token transfers within smart contracts.

Account Balances: Querying specific balances of tokens held by any given wallet address on the BSC.

To utilize this data, a developer typically makes API requests to the BscScan API endpoint with their unique API key included in the request header. This allows for a seamless and secure flow of transactional information from the blockchain to an application or service.

Best Practices: Keeping Your BsCscan API Key Secure

While the BSCAN API key opens up a world of possibilities for blockchain interaction, it is vital to use these keys with caution and respect their value as secure access tokens. Here are some best practices:

Keep your API key secret: Never share your API key publicly or embed it directly into application interfaces without proper authentication checks.

Limit exposure: Use environment variables instead of hardcoded values in applications where possible, to prevent accidental disclosure.

Regularly review and manage your keys: Keep track of your keys, rotating them periodically for security reasons.

Use HTTPS/TLS encryption: Ensure all API requests are secured using a protocol like HTTPS/TLS.
